Plain-English Summary
The federal government would create a new program to help K-12 schools improve their cybersecurity defenses and technology systems, protecting student data and school networks from hackers and cyber attacks. The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ency would run this program, likely providing schools with resources, training, or funding to upgrade their security measures. This would affect school districts, students, and families by helping ensure that sensitive educational records and school systems are better protected from cyber threats.
